Dominique You is a human[1]. He was born in Gassin[2]. He was born on July 3, 1955[3]. He worked as a theologian[4], Catholic priest[5], and Catholic bishop[6]. He has Wikipedia articles in 5 language editions, a strong signal of global cultural recognition.[7]
